Handscribed Log HomeThe coping of logs is quite an art and guarantees that your home will be unique. We even invite people to see the final touches being put on their logs. It’s always impressive seeing how archways can be curved.

The loft floor beams, roof beams, and porch posts and beams are hand-peeled and scribe-fit. Post & beam connections are done with mortise and tenon joinery, which adds strength as well as beauty to your log home.

Our handcrafted log homes are made with your choice of Western Red Cedar or West Coast Douglas fir , with an average diameter of 12 inches. Western cedar and Douglas f ir are among the most resilient and resistant species in the world. Because of the consistent length of our logs, we guarantee there will be no butt-joints; all logs are full length.

Once all of the fitting and assembly is complete and the log ends are curved and finished, the next stage is drilling for electrical wiring. The logs are then disassembled and loaded on trucks together with the rest of your complete materials package for shipment to your site. Re-assembly of all logs and post and beam work only takes two or three days!
